Subject: [for-linus][PATCH 14/17] tools/bootconfig: Fix to use correct quotes for value

From: Masami Hiramatsu <mhiramat@kernel.org>
Fix bootconfig tool to select double or single quotes
correctly according to the value.
If a bootconfig value includes a double quote character,
we must use single-quotes to quote that value.

tools/bootconfig/main.c | 14 ++++++++------
1 file changed, 8 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
diff --git a/tools/bootconfig/main.c b/tools/bootconfig/main.c
index 0efaf45f7367..21896a6675fd 100644
--- a/tools/bootconfig/main.c
+++ b/tools/bootconfig/main.c
@@ -14,13 +14,18 @@
#include <linux/kernel.h>
#include <linux/bootconfig.h>
-static int xbc_show_array(struct xbc_node *node)
+static int xbc_show_value(struct xbc_node *node)
{
const char *val;
+ char q;
int i = 0;
xbc_array_for_each_value(node, val) {
- printf("\"%s\"%s", val, node->next ? ", " : ";\n");
+ if (strchr(val, '"'))
+ q = '\'';
+ else
+ q = '"';
+ printf("%c%s%c%s", q, val, q, node->next ? ", " : ";\n");
i++;
}
return i;
@@ -48,10 +53,7 @@ static void xbc_show_compact_tree(void)
continue;
} else if (cnode && xbc_node_is_value(cnode)) {
printf("%s = ", xbc_node_get_data(node));
- if (cnode->next)
- xbc_show_array(cnode);
- else
- printf("\"%s\";\n", xbc_node_get_data(cnode));
+ xbc_show_value(cnode);
} else {
printf("%s;\n", xbc_node_get_data(node));
}
